Key Elements of a Contemporary Eco Apartment Renovation
- Energy-Efficient Systems: Upgrade to energy-efficient appliances, lighting, and HVAC systems to reduce energy consumption and lower your utility bills.
- Renewable Energy Sources: Consider incorporating solar panels, wind turbines, or geothermal systems to generate clean energy and reduce your reliance on fossil fuels.
- Water Conservation: Install low-flow fixtures, greywater systems, and rainwater harvesting systems to minimize water waste and reduce your water bills.
- Eco-Friendly Materials: Choose sustainable building materials, such as reclaimed wood, bamboo, and low-VOC paints, to reduce your carbon footprint and promote healthier indoor air quality.
- Smart Home Technology: Incorporate smart home devices and systems to monitor and control energy consumption, water usage, and other aspects of your apartment's ecosystem.
Practical Strategies for a Successful Contemporary Eco Apartment Renovation
Implementing eco-friendly principles in your apartment renovation requires careful planning and execution. Here are some practical strategies to consider:

- Assess Your Needs: Conduct a thorough assessment of your apartment's energy efficiency, water consumption, and indoor air quality to identify areas for improvement.
- Set Realistic Goals: Establish clear objectives for your renovation, including budget constraints, timeline, and sustainable goals.
- Choose Eco-Friendly Materials: Select materials that meet your sustainability goals, such as reclaimed wood, low-VOC paints, and sustainable insulation.
- Invest in Energy-Efficient Systems: Upgrade to energy-efficient appliances, lighting, and HVAC systems to reduce energy consumption and lower your utility bills.
- Monitor and Maintain: Regularly monitor your apartment's energy consumption, water usage, and indoor air quality, and maintain your eco-friendly systems to ensure optimal performance.
